  7. Hi Guys! Thank You for the kind words and the congratulations ... Shay and I spoke last night and we booked the airline tickets for the 14th of April .... I couldn't believe the prices of tickets had doubled in a span of a week to week and a half!

    Seriously thou, the interview is nowhere as scary as we work ourselves up to believe ... The people are really nice and they just get to it, no fluffing around... The first lady I saw went thru all the paperwork that I submitted for the pack 3 and put it in the correct order, asked me when I was planning to fly out etc ... Really basic, general stuff...

    The same with the actual interviewer ... the questions are really simple that you should know about your partner already ... I had a mountain of evidence with me and they didn't even ask to see one thing, not one letter or phone bill, nothing! ... the only things they asked for were the envelope, visa application fee and passport ..

    All in all I was there for 1hour and 15min ... There was 7 immigration visa before me, 3 of which were fiance visa's and they all got approved the only one not approved was the guy with the pending court date but thats not surprising .. so they gave him a piece of paper and told him to send in the court papers etc after the court hearing in May...

    I arrived early at the embassy and went up to the 10th floor and went thru security ... they gave me a number and kept my handbage and let me keep my paperwork... I was then called and told I could go up to the the 59th floor for my interview ...

    When I got there (15min early) I had to take a number and was soon called up and spoke to a young lady who took my finger prints and went thru my paperwork and asked for my passport, visa receipt and envelope ... when she was done she told me to go sit down and that I would soon get called up for my interview .... by 9.15 I was called up and spoke to a really nice young man...

    He asked me when I was getting married and I said the 2nd of May and were and I said in {Town} Oregon he asked me if Id ever been to the states and I said no and that Shay had been to Oz for 5 weeks... he asked me if I thought I would enjoy country life and I replied that I didnt know because Id never lived in a country town before but I was sure looking forward to seeing the wildlife, except the bears, Id be more then happy to pass on the bears ... he then asked me what Shay did for a living I said he was a Chef and he asked me what I intended to do in the states and I said have babies :lol: and explained that Im 38 and his 39 and we both really want to start a family asap ... thru the whole encounter he seemed to be smiling in all the right places and seemed to be satisfied with my answers and said that he was going to approve my visa and that I would receive it in the mail in a few days ... I asked him when he thought it may arrive and he said more then likely end of the week or the beginning of next ... I said thank you very much and was there anything else and he said no that, that was it and that I had 6months from date of issue but it sounded that we had more current plans and he wished us all the best ...

    Overall a very good experience, I wasnt made to feel at all anxious and thats saying something because I a few minutes earlier I had watched a guy have his denied because he had a pending court date...
